NASTRAN is really a finite ingredient Examination (FEA) system that was originally developed for NASA inside the late sixties under Usa government funding to the aerospace market.

The NASTRAN method has advanced around numerous versions. Each individual new edition is made up of enhancements in Examination capability and numerical overall performance. Right now, NASTRAN is greatly made use of all over the entire world during the aerospace, automotive and maritime industries.
